In a troubling incident that has left the Asheville community reeling, police have arrested 60-year-old John Reynolds Malloy IV on charges related to child sexual abuse. The police moved in swiftly, booking Malloy into the Buncombe County Detention Facility after he was charged with Felony Indecent Liberties With a Child and Misdemeanor Child Abuse. The event that prompted this arrest dates back to November 2024, but specifics surrounding the case have not yet been disclosed to the public.
Authorities say that the investigation was a team effort, working closely with the Rutherford County Department of Social Services. This collaborative approach emphasizes the seriousness of the allegations and highlights the importance of keeping our children safe. A magistrate has issued a secured bond of $30,000 for Malloy, who is now awaiting further developments in his case.
In light of this serious accusation, Asheville police are asking residents to assist in their investigation. If you have any information related to this case, you are encouraged to reach out to the Asheville Police Department at (828) 252-1110. For those who prefer anonymity, tips can be submitted using the TIP2APD smartphone application or by texting TIP2APD to 847411.
